Output e8e90bfd11b5be6ee160be19a6d247698174da792ff16d2ef3f4e169b51158fa:1

value
54679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c55a872f0ab3b7b15cde4c136d13acdd1533b3a OP_EQUAL
address
3EV392FodwjXZb2a8gXw2pqLur7Ux5nPpd
transaction
e8e90bfd11b5be6ee160be19a6d247698174da792ff16d2ef3f4e169b51158fa
confirmations
283094
spent
true